WebThe Parish of Finglas West made up the balance of money from a bank loan. Work on a new church (Church of the Annunciation) began with the turning of the first sod in July 1964 and was duly opened on Sunday the 8th October 1967 by the Archbishop of Dublin, Charles McQuaid.
